I took this photograph from the same bench where for four months I managed to see incredible sunrises and sunsets, as well as people passing by and interacting with that imposing nature characteristic of South Africa.

 

In particular, I was always struck by these people who for some time came and went, at almost any time of the day, to extract sand from the beach to build their houses. I was observing the interaction between them and the technique not only in the excavation, but  also, the one to enter and leave with the vans from the beach.

 

I remember that sometimes they even came with huge cargo vehicles, but what I could always denote as a constant was that the one who drove, never excavated.
